C# Class Microsoft.SqlServer.TDS.Row.TDSRowTokenBase

Base class for token that corresponds to the row of data
Inheritance: TDSPacketToken
显示文件 Open project: dotnet/corefx

Public Methods

Method Description
TDSRowTokenBase ( TDSColMetadataToken metadata ) : System

Initialization constructor

Protected Methods

Method Description
DeflateColumn ( Stream destination, TDSColumnData column, object data ) : void

Deflate the column into the stream

InflateColumn ( Stream source, TDSColumnData column ) : object

Inflate a particular column from the stream

Method Details

DeflateColumn() protected method

Deflate the column into the stream
protected DeflateColumn ( Stream destination, TDSColumnData column, object data ) : void
destination Stream Stream to deflate token to
column Microsoft.SqlServer.TDS.ColMetadata.TDSColumnData Column metadata
data object Column value
return void

InflateColumn() protected method

Inflate a particular column from the stream
protected InflateColumn ( Stream source, TDSColumnData column ) : object
source Stream Stream to inflate the column from
column Microsoft.SqlServer.TDS.ColMetadata.TDSColumnData Metadata about the column
return object

TDSRowTokenBase() public method

Initialization constructor
public TDSRowTokenBase ( TDSColMetadataToken metadata ) : System
metadata Microsoft.SqlServer.TDS.ColMetadata.TDSColMetadataToken
return System